📖 About Chikwawa

Chikwawa is a town with a population of 6,114 according to the 2018 census located in the Southern Region of Malawi on the west bank of the Shire River.

It is the administrative capital of the Chikwawa District.

Chikwawa lies almost 50 kilometres (30 mi) south of Blantyre, the commercial capital of Malawi.
